>> - Change the check_link to true in patches 3 and 4 and then you can add to >> the >> all the commit messages something like: >> Test results: >> Nvidia GeForce 840M - >> NVIDIA 352.41: pass >> > These actually puzzle me quite a bit. The spec is quite clear that > those should be a compile-time errors. By setting the check_link, > we'll be doing a link-time check. Should we ignore the Nvidia's driver > behaviour, or just toggle it on and add a note "this should really be > off, as we want to do a compile-time check" like note ? > Can people cast their 2c on the above topic ? Currently we have some ~180 'compile' tests which resort to link checking. From a quick look I cannot see any comments/justification - did those fall victims of copy/paste or it's deliberate. Perhaps we should pick our favourite and document it ?
